В исследование включено 529 пациентов с ИМпST, которые разделены на 2 группы: 1-я группа — пациенты с диагностированной ранее ХОБЛ — 65 человек (12,3%), 2-я — пациенты без ХОБЛ — 464 человека (87,7%). Диагноз ХОБЛ верифицировался на основании заключений в медицинской амбулаторной документации. Всем пациентам при поступлении проведены коронароангиография и ангиопластика со стентированием инфарктзависимой артерии. Оценка лабораторных показателей проводилась на 10–14 сутки от начала ИМ.</p></sec><sec><title>Результаты</title><p>Результаты. У больных ИМпST с сопутствующей ХОБЛ значимо чаще наблюдалось осложненное течение госпитального периода инфаркта миокарда. Госпитальная летальность от инфаркта миокарда в группе с сопутствующей ХОБЛ также оказалась более высокой. Через 1 год после инфаркта миокарда зарегистрировано больше конечных точек у пациентов с ХОБЛ. В этой же группе выше значения NT-proBNP на 10 день течения инфаркта миокарда.</p></sec><sec><title>Заключение</title><p>Заключение. В Кемеровской области встречаемость ХОБЛ среди пациентов с ИМпST составила 12,3%. Хроническая обструктивная болезнь легких ассоциирована с неблагоприятными исходами госпитального и годового периодов инфаркта миокарда и характеризуется большим числом осложнений. To study the immediate and long-term outcomes of STEMI in patients with concomitant COPD in Kuzbass. Material and methods. Totally 529 patients with STEMI included. They were divided into 2 groups: 1st — patients with COPD diagnosed before (65 pts., 12,3%), 2nd — patients without COPD (464 pts.— 87,7%). The diagnosis of COPD was verified by anamnesis morbi in outpatient records. At admittance all patients underwent coronary angiography and angioplastic with infarct-depending artery stenting. Laboratory values were assessed by 10-14 days after MI. Results. There was higher prevalence of complicated in-hospital MI course in patients with STEMI and COPD. In-hospital mortality was also higher. After 1 year more endpoints registered for those with COPD. In this group the levels of NT- proBNP at the 10th after MI were higher.</p></trans-abstract><kwd-group xml:lang="ru"><kwd>инфаркт миокарда с подъемом ST</kwd><kwd>хроническая обструктивная болезнь легких</kwd><kwd>коморбидная патология</kwd></kwd-group><kwd-group xml:lang="en"><kwd>ST elevation myocardial infarction</kwd><kwd>chronic obstructive pulmonary disease</kwd><kwd>comorbidity</kwd></kwd-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Report on the status and protection of the environment of the Kemerovo region in 2011.
